The development team don't anticipate changing the file format in the foreseeable future for the Standard, Professional, Enterprise and Corporate Editions.
They do, however, expect to offer different file format options for the SQL (Corporate) Edition in the future. Our understanding is that the 64-bit versions of Windows will still be able to run all 32-bit applications.
